Hong Kong Authorities Investigate Hounax in Alleged Scam

The SFC and Hong Kong Police are looking into Hounax, an unlicensed cryptocurrency exchange, following 145 fraud claims. After multiple people connected to the JPEX cryptocurrency scam were taken into custody, Hounax, a different virtual asset trading site situated in Hong Kong, was shut down.
